| i guess you mean the miniEPG??? it#s still there. mapping has changed and it was removed from the context menu if thats the point where you miss it.. it's now "ok" on MCE remote respectivly "Enter" on your keyboard where back in the past the "switch to last channel"function was(it's on "0" now by the way) hope that helped, but if i were you, i would read the SVN-"changelog" beofre upgrading - so that surprises like this don't happen anymore (-; edit: 2late (-; |
